Understanding Private Laser Hair Removal
Laser hair removal has become a popular choice for those seeking a long-term solution to unwanted hair. Its appeal lies in the promise of smooth, hair-free skin without the constant need for shaving or waxing. However, the idea of undergoing such a procedure can be intimidating for some, especially when considering the privacy and comfort aspects. Private laser hair removal offers a solution by providing a more personalized and discreet experience.
Private laser hair removal is conducted in a setting that prioritizes the client’s comfort and confidentiality. This approach often involves personalized consultations, where professionals tailor the treatment plan to the individual’s needs. The sessions are conducted in private rooms, ensuring that clients feel at ease throughout the process.
Choosing private laser hair removal can offer numerous benefits. These include:
- Customized treatment plans that cater to specific skin types and hair colors.
- Flexible scheduling to accommodate personal preferences and availability.
- Enhanced privacy, reducing any potential discomfort or embarrassment.
Understanding the nuances of private laser hair removal can help individuals make informed decisions about their hair removal journey. It’s essential to research and choose a reputable provider who can offer the necessary expertise and care.
Comparing Laser Hair Removal Technologies
When considering private laser hair removal, it’s crucial to understand the different technologies available. Each type of laser has its unique characteristics, making it suitable for various skin and hair types. The most common laser technologies include Alexandrite, Diode, and Nd:YAG lasers.
The Alexandrite laser is known for its speed and effectiveness on light to olive skin tones. It operates at a wavelength that is ideal for targeting the melanin in the hair follicle, making it a popular choice for many clients. However, it may not be suitable for darker skin tones due to the risk of pigmentation changes.
Diode lasers are versatile and can be used on a broader range of skin tones. They penetrate deeper into the skin, which can be advantageous for treating coarser hair. This technology offers a balance between speed and precision, making it a favored option for many seeking private laser hair removal.
Nd:YAG lasers are specifically designed for darker skin tones. They operate at a longer wavelength, reducing the risk of skin damage and pigmentation issues. While they may require more sessions to achieve the desired results, they offer a safer alternative for individuals with more melanin-rich skin.
Choosing the right laser technology is a critical step in ensuring a successful and comfortable hair removal experience. Consulting with a knowledgeable provider can help determine the best option based on individual skin and hair characteristics.
Preparing for Your Private Laser Hair Removal Session
Preparation is key to maximizing the effectiveness of private laser hair removal. Before the session, it’s important to follow specific guidelines to ensure the skin is in optimal condition for treatment.
Firstly, avoid sun exposure and tanning for at least two weeks before the session. Tanned skin can increase the risk of burns and pigmentation issues, making it crucial to keep the skin as close to its natural tone as possible. Additionally, refrain from using any self-tanning products.
Shaving the treatment area 24 to 48 hours before the session is recommended. This ensures that the laser targets the hair follicle effectively without the interference of surface hair. However, avoid waxing or plucking, as these methods remove the hair follicle, which is needed for the laser to work.
On the day of the appointment, cleanse the skin thoroughly and avoid applying lotions, creams, or deodorants to the area. These products can interfere with the laser’s ability to penetrate the skin effectively.
Finally, wear loose-fitting clothing to the appointment to avoid irritation post-treatment. The skin may be sensitive, and tight clothing can cause discomfort.
By taking these preparatory steps, individuals can enhance the effectiveness of their private laser hair removal sessions and enjoy smoother, hair-free skin with greater ease and comfort.
